Travelers visit Chicago from around the world to see its many world-famous attractions. There are countless landmarks, museums, and iconic sights in the area. Some of the most famous are the Art Institute of Chicago, Adler Planetarium, and the Museum of Science and Industry. Notable landmarks include the famous Willis Tower - formerly the Sears Tower, Buckingham Fountain, and the iconic Cloud Gate (the bean).

Known for it's food and restaurant scene, Chicago is always at the top of any foodie's travel list. With everything from award-winning luxury restaurants to local dives, this city has something for everyone. It also has very distinct local flavors and dishes that create an identity and bring great pride to the locals. While you're in town you have to try the famous deep dish pizza, Chicago style hot dogs, and Italian beef.
Visitors will find a budding food and restaurant scene in San Jose. Most people miss out on local cuisine during their time in Costa Rica, but the capital city offers the best opportunities to eat like a local. You can sample favorite local dishes such as chifrijo, gallo pinto, rondón, and casado. You should also wander through the Central Market and dine at one of the many local restaurants.

Chicago is known as a music capital around the world. The city is the birthplace of such interesting styles as modern gospel and the Chicago style blues.

Chicago is an amazing family-friendly city to visit. The city has a large number of activities for kids, including zoos, Shedd Aquarium, impressive children's museums, and large and elaborate playgrounds in Millennium Park. It's easy to keep kids entertained in this very kid-focused city.
San Jose doesn't usually come to mind when thinking about kid-friendly destinations. Most people pass through the city quickly, but if you have a day or two to explore, you can visit the Children's Museum (Museo de los Niños), Spirogyra Butterfly Gardens, or explore the Central Market.

Chicago has an effecient and thorough public transportation system which can take you anywhere in the city. There's a subway (the "L"), a commuter well, as well as buses and countless taxis available.
You'll find some public transit in San Jose, but it may not be enough to take you everywhere. There are local buses that travel through the city during the daytime hours.

The average daily cost (per person) in San Jose is $115, while the average daily cost in Chicago is $323.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. Chicago has a temperate climate with four distinct seasons, but San Jose experiences a warm climate with fairly sunny weather most of the year.
Both Chicago and San Jose during the summer are popular places to visit. Plenty of visitors come to San Jose because of the warm climate and sunshine that lasts throughout the year. Furthermore, the summer months attract visitors to Chicago because of the beaches, the city activities, the music scene, and the family-friendly experiences.
In July, San Jose is generally around the same temperature as Chicago. Daily temperatures in San Jose average around 28°C (82°F), and Chicago fluctuates around 77°F (25°C).
In Chicago, it's very sunny this time of the year. In the summer, San Jose often gets less sunshine than Chicago. San Jose gets 164 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Chicago receives 326 hours of full sun.
Chicago gets a good bit of rain this time of year. It rains a lot this time of the year in San Jose. San Jose usually gets more rain in July than Chicago. San Jose gets 164 mm (6.5 in) of rain, while Chicago receives 3.9 inches (100 mm) of rain this time of the year.

San Jose is much warmer than Chicago in the autumn. The daily temperature in San Jose averages around 27°C (81°F) in October, and Chicago fluctuates around 56°F (14°C).
San Jose usually receives less sunshine than Chicago during autumn. San Jose gets 169 hours of sunny skies, while Chicago receives 195 hours of full sun in the autumn.
San Jose gets a good bit of rain this time of year. In October, San Jose usually receives more rain than Chicago. San Jose gets 254 mm (10 in) of rain, while Chicago receives 2.2 inches (56 mm) of rain each month for the autumn. December to April in San Jose is the dry season. Be prepared for some very cold days in Chicago. In the winter, San Jose is much warmer than Chicago. Typically, the winter temperatures in San Jose in January average around 27°C (81°F), and Chicago averages at about 25°F (-4°C).
People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in San Jose this time of the year. In the winter, San Jose often gets more sunshine than Chicago. San Jose gets 264 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Chicago receives 134 hours of full sun.
San Jose usually gets less rain in January than Chicago. San Jose gets 8 mm (0.3 in) of rain, while Chicago receives 1.9 inches (47 mm) of rain this time of the year.

In April, San Jose is generally much warmer than Chicago. Daily temperatures in San Jose average around 29°C (85°F), and Chicago fluctuates around 52°F (11°C).
It's quite sunny in Chicago. The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in San Jose. San Jose usually receives more sunshine than Chicago during spring. San Jose gets 255 hours of sunny skies, while Chicago receives 218 hours of full sun in the spring.
It rains a lot this time of the year in Chicago. In April, San Jose usually receives less rain than Chicago. San Jose gets 28 mm (1.1 in) of rain, while Chicago receives 4.3 inches (108 mm) of rain each month for the spring. The dry season in San Jose is December to April. | San Jose | Chicago |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| |
| Jan | 27°C (81°F) | 8 mm (0.3 in) | 25°F (-4°C) | 1.9 inches (47 mm) |
| Feb | 28°C (83°F) | 2 mm (0.1 in) | 29°F (-2°C) | 1.4 inches (35 mm) |
| Mar | 29°C (84°F) | 4 mm (0.2 in) | 41°F (5°C) | 3.7 inches (93 mm) |
| Apr | 29°C (85°F) | 28 mm (1.1 in) | 52°F (11°C) | 4.3 inches (108 mm) |
| May | 29°C (83°F) | 226 mm (8.9 in) | 63°F (17°C) | 3 inches (75 mm) |
| Jun | 28°C (82°F) | 226 mm (8.9 in) | 73°F (23°C) | 3.9 inches (100 mm) |
| Jul | 28°C (82°F) | 164 mm (6.5 in) | 77°F (25°C) | 3.9 inches (100 mm) |
| Aug | 26°C (79°F) | 289 mm (11.4 in) | 76°F (24°C) | 3.5 inches (90 mm) |
| Sep | 28°C (82°F) | 328 mm (12.9 in) | 68°F (20°C) | 3.8 inches (96 mm) |
| Oct | 27°C (81°F) | 254 mm (10 in) | 56°F (14°C) | 2.2 inches (56 mm) |
| Nov | 27°C (81°F) | 121 mm (4.8 in) | 44°F (7°C) | 2.2 inches (56 mm) |
| Dec | 27°C (81°F) | 33 mm (1.3 in) | 31°F (-1°C) | 2.8 inches (71 mm) |
